A U.S. appeals court refused Thursday to revive a lawsuit against UBS AG (UBSN.VX) by U.S. victims of Hamas and Hezbollah attacks in Israel who claimed the bank aided international terrorism.

The 2nd U.S. Circuit Court of Appeals in New York said the plaintiffs could not obtain relief against the Swiss bank on their claims. However, it also ruled a trial judge was wrong in holding that the victims lacked the legal standing to bring the case under federal terrorism laws.
